For the first time ever in my life I tried a Kiwano Horned Fruit….I couldn’t resist the cool colors!  (OMG ~ the descriptions on this how to have me rolling on the floor ~ Yup, I am totally a kid like that!

Have any of you ever had these???

IMG_5721

Prickly on the outside, funky green on the inside.  The texture is like slimy seeds with crunchy seeds ~ sorta like a melon/kiwi/cucumber flavor.  I didn’t eat the skin…I am not that brave.

After work I headed out to my Weight Watcher’s Meeting.  I’ve decided it’s time to set some goals to work towards because honestly I NEED to have something to work on to be successful.

This week I am going to

  —> journal EVERY SINGLE BITE I take and count it all ~ including measuring out a serving.

  —> Drink 80+ oz water each day

  —> Focus on meeting all 9 Healthy Guidelines daily

  —> Bust out my Week 1 materials and read through each week like today is my first day back at Weight Watchers….It never hurts to brush up 🙂

My SHORT TERM GOAL is to lose 12 lbs before we go on our Bahamas Cruise in August!

I think that  my goals are very do-able and realistic.  I think I will probably join in with my WW friend and set up a bank account to add $10 for each pound lost so at the end, I have $120 to spend on clothes or anything I might want 😀
